Hi! We are a family of five (parents with three kids, ages 15,12,9) soon to be first time cruisers. We are very excited, but very clueless.

The ship sponsored shore excursions are quite expensive. Does anyone have any ideas/contact info for other excursion options? Our ports of call include Naples,Palmermo,Tunis, Livorno (Florence),Calvi (Corsica), Monte Carlo and Marseille.

Thanks so much in advance for any responses!

Many of the ports are great for Do It Yourself, if you are willing to do the work planning. For instance. In Naples, it is eacy to get a tram to the train station. (See Rick Steves' book above). From there a train will take you to places like Pompeii or Sorrento.

Just remember to get back to the ship in plenty of time. Usually, they will tell you to get back at a certain time (which is a few minutes before sailing). I always try to be back onboard at least 30 minutes before the announced time. They won't wait if you are not on one of their excursions.
